Hello! My name is Paula and I have been reading the FML for some time and
dreaming of the day my husband Matt and I could become full-time ferret
friends. Today was that day. We have two adorable 3 mo old females,
neutered and descented. We *did* buy them from a pet shop but a very
reputable one. The girls are as frisky and playful as can be, but we have
two questions:  1) How can we stop them from playing in the litter box?
One book mentions that if you mix feces into the litter they will get the
idea, but we've done that and they are still kicking the stuff everywhere
and acting like it's a sandbox.  2) Are collars best used only when
outside or always? I think I would rather use the harnesses mentioned in
previous FML issues, but would leaving harnesses on even when at home and
out of the cage raise any issues?
